Average Number of Trauma Cases Seen per Year at Memorial Hermann-Texas Medical Center*

Adult (ages 16 and older) 5,871
Pediatric (ages 15 and younger) 1,197
Total 14,315 (across entire Memorial Hermann Health System for adult and pediatric)

Most Common Types of Trauma Cases Seen at Memorial Hermann-Texas Medical Center*

Adult

  • Motor Vehicle Accidents
  • Falls
  • Assault
  • Motorcycle Accidents
  • Burns

Pediatric

  • Falls
  • Motor Vehicle Accidents
  • Burns
  • Sports Injuries
  • Auto Pedestrian Accidents

*This data was requested from the Memorial Hermann Hospital-Texas Medical Center & Children's Memorial Hermann Hospital Trauma Registry Database from 2014. The trauma diagnoses were classified by the E Code Matrix for Mortality and Morbidity Data (E800 – E959.9; excluding adverse effects E930 – E947.9). (This does not include patients that were discharged from the ED.)

Total Licensed Beds

Children's 278
Women's 68
Heart & Vascular Institute 147
Adult 589
Total 1,082

Red Duke Trauma Institute

Emergency Department 8
Trauma IMU 12
Trauma ICU 23
Pediatric ICU 20
Acute Trauma 64
John S. Dunn Burn Center 14
Neurotrauma ICU 12
Acute Neurotrauma 24
Inpatient Rehabilitation 23
Total Beds 200
